Tobias Clemens (born August 14, 1979) is a former German professional tennis player, who played mainly on the ATP Challenger Tour and ITF Futures tournaments.
His best result was at ATP Metz 2006 where he reached the quarter-finals as a qualifier and lost to future world number one tennis player Novak Djokovic 4–6, 1–6.
